About this data
Share of men (% of adult population), who are underweight, healthy/normal, overweight or obese based on body mass index (BMI). Body Mass Index (BMI) is a person's weight divided by their height squared. The WHO define a BMI <=18.5 as underweight; 18.6 to 25.0 as normal/healthy; 25.1 to 30 as overweight; and >30.0 as obese.
